/sudoku-solver-itsp-2018

Computer-vision-based sudoku solver and block printer. Institute Technical Summer Project at IIT Bombay.

Primary LanguagePythonMIT LicenseMIT

ITSP-2018

Sudoku Solver Using Block Printing

As part of the Institute Technical Summer Project at IIT Bombay, my team implemented a Raspian-based CNC Machine to physically fill into any given unsolved Sudoku grid.

Accompanying YouTube video


Two phases: Digit recognition and Motor control. Code written in Python.

Key Components: Raspberry Pi 3B, Camera Module, 2 Steppers, 2 Servos, Number Stamp

Overview

Build1

Motors

Build2

Number Stamp

Build3

Image Processing

Thresholded:

IP1

Labelled:

IP1

Authors

Created with ❤️ by Siddharth and Aaron